Local Memphis Woman Re-Designs

Martha Nash

Martha Nash went from interiors to exteriors when she started designing handbags. The former interior designer lost her job when the recession hit the Memphis economy. With her home as her studio, Nash took leftover fabric from her days of home and office design and started sewing. Nash prides herself on unique designs using mid-century modern textiles from designers like Alexander Girard and manufacturers like Herman Miller.

Nash appreciates her unique style and considers her bags pieces of art. She combined talents with local Memphis artist Patrick Greene and together they have created what they consider wearable art. Their bags are sold at boutiques across the mid-south.
